China has condemned the US naval blockade of Iranian ports, calling it irresponsible. The move is said to undermine an already fragile ceasefire in the region. Tensions rise even as China remains Iran's largest oil buyer.
US Naval Blockade
The United States has implemented a naval blockade on Iranian ports, a move that has drawn international criticism. The blockade is intended to pressure Iran amid ongoing geopolitical tensions. The US Navy has deployed several vessels to enforce the blockade, affecting maritime traffic in the region.
China's Response
China, a major economic partner of Iran, has publicly criticized the US action. Chinese officials argue that the blockade threatens regional stability and undermines diplomatic efforts. As Iran's largest oil customer, China's economic interests are directly impacted by the blockade.
What's Next
The UN Security Council is expected to discuss the situation in the coming days. It remains unclear how the blockade will affect ongoing peace negotiations.
